A crowd gathered in front of the Latta Town Hall this (Tuesday) afternoon in support of Latta Police Chief Crystal Moore, who was terminated earlier today.
Councilman Jarett Taylor, who was present, encouraged those in attendance to attend the Latta Town Council meeting on Thursday at 5:30 p.m. to voice their opinions.
By telephone, Mayor Earl Bullard told The Herald that he would not comment on Moore’s termination due to the fact that it was a personnel issue, but stated that it involved more than one thing and more than one incident.
Derrick Cartwright will be serving as interim police chief.
